Signing Up and Creating an FT Account
Alright, folks, before we can even think about signing in, we need to make sure you have an active FT account. If you're new to the Financial Times, this is where it all begins. Creating an account is generally a straightforward process, but let's break it down step-by-step so you're all set. First things first, head over to the FT website – you can usually find a 'Register' or 'Sign Up' link prominently displayed on the homepage. Click on that, and you'll be prompted to provide some basic information. This often includes your email address, a password (make sure it’s a strong one!), and some personal details. The FT might ask for your name, location, and other relevant info. This information helps them tailor your experience and offer you content that’s relevant to your interests. It’s also used for account verification and security purposes. Remember to review the terms and conditions and privacy policy before submitting your information. Once you've filled out the form, you’ll typically receive a verification email. Check your inbox (and your spam folder, just in case) for an email from the FT. This email will contain a link you need to click to verify your email address and activate your account. This is a crucial step; without verifying your email, you won't be able to access the FT ePaper. If you’re already a print subscriber, the process might be slightly different. You may need to link your print subscription to your online account. This usually involves entering your subscriber details, such as your account number or postal address, to confirm your subscription. Once your account is set up, you'll be able to sign in and enjoy all the benefits of the FT ePaper. For those who are already subscribers, make sure you know your print subscription details. Navigating the FT ePaper Sign-In Process
Okay, so you've got your FT account all set up – awesome! Now, let’s get you signed in and ready to dive into the FT ePaper. The sign-in process is designed to be user-friendly, but here's a detailed walkthrough to make it even easier. First, open your web browser or the FT app on your device. Whether you’re on a laptop, tablet, or smartphone, the sign-in process should be very similar. Locate the 'Sign In' button – it's usually at the top right corner of the website or in the app's menu. Click on this button, and you'll be directed to the sign-in page. On the sign-in page, you'll be prompted to enter your login credentials. This is where you’ll need the email address and password you used when you created your FT account. Make sure you type everything correctly, paying close attention to capitalization and special characters. After entering your details, click the 'Sign In' button. If your credentials are correct, you’ll be immediately directed to the FT ePaper. If you are using a mobile device, there is also the option to stay logged in. This prevents you from having to enter your credentials every time, making it easier to quickly check the news when you are on the go. If you are facing any login issues, make sure you have a stable internet connection. A poor connection could cause issues. You also should make sure you have the correct login information. Forgetting your password? No problem. The FT usually provides a 'Forgot Password' link on the sign-in page. Click this, and you'll be prompted to enter your email address. The FT will then send you instructions on how to reset your password. Once you're signed in, you can start exploring the FT ePaper. You’ll have access to all the articles, features, and sections just like in the print edition, but with the added convenience of digital access. Troubleshooting Common FT ePaper Sign-In Issues
Alright, guys, let's face it: sometimes, things don't go as planned. Even with the most user-friendly platforms, you might run into a few snags when trying to sign into your FT ePaper. Don't worry, we've got you covered. Here's a guide to troubleshooting some common sign-in issues. Problem: Incorrect Login Credentials. This is, by far, the most common issue. Double-check that you’re entering the correct email address and password. Make sure Caps Lock isn't on and that there are no extra spaces before or after your username and password. If you've forgotten your password, use the 'Forgot Password' link to reset it. Solution: Review your credentials and reset your password if needed. Problem: Account Not Activated. If you haven’t verified your email address after creating your account, you won’t be able to sign in. Solution: Check your inbox for the verification email from the FT and click the link to activate your account. If you didn’t receive the email, check your spam folder, or request a new verification email. Problem: Technical Glitches. Sometimes, there are temporary issues with the FT website or app. Solution: Try clearing your browser’s cache and cookies. If you're using the app, try closing and reopening it or reinstalling it. Check the FT’s official social media channels or website for any reported issues. Problem: Subscription Issues. If you have a paid subscription and you're still unable to access the ePaper, there might be an issue with your subscription. Solution: Contact FT customer support to verify your subscription status. Make sure your payment details are up-to-date. Problem: Browser Compatibility. Some older browsers might not fully support the FT website. Solution: Ensure you're using an up-to-date version of a modern browser like Chrome, Firefox, Safari, or Edge. Regularly updating your web browser can avoid compatibility problems. If all else fails, reach out to FT customer support. They're usually very responsive and can help you resolve more complex issues. Staying Secure and Protecting Your FT Account
Now that you're a regular FT ePaper user, it's crucial to prioritize the security of your account. Keeping your login details safe helps protect your personal information and ensures that your access to the FT ePaper remains uninterrupted. Here's a guide to maintaining account security. Create a Strong Password: Use a strong, unique password for your FT account. This means a password that’s at least 12 characters long, including a mix of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id using easily guessable information like your name, birthdate, or common words. Regularly Update Your Password: Change your password periodically, such as every few months, to enhance security. This reduces the risk of your account being compromised. Be Wary of Phishing: Phishing attacks involve fake emails or websites designed to steal your login credentials. Be cautious of any suspicious emails or links that ask for your FT account information. Always go directly to the FT website by typing the address in your browser.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): If the FT offers it (and many services do), enable two-factor authentication. This adds an extra layer of security by requiring a code from your phone or another device in addition to your password. Use a Secure Device: Ensure your devices (computer, tablet, smartphone) are protected with strong passwords and updated security software. Avoid using public or unsecured Wi-Fi networks when accessing your FT account. Keep Your Software Updated: Regularly update your operating system, web browser, and any apps you use to access the FT ePaper. Updates often include important security patches. Monitor Your Account Activity: Keep an eye on your account activity. If you notice any unusual activity, such as unrecognized logins or changes to your account details, report it to the FT immediately. Report Suspicious Activity: If you receive a suspicious email or encounter a website that looks like a phishing attempt, report it to the FT and relevant authorities. Protecting your account is an ongoing process. Following these steps can significantly reduce your risk of security breaches and keep your FT ePaper experience safe and enjoyable.
